Egidio Viganò – “Letter of the Rector Major” in “Acts of the Superior Council of the salesian society”

In this letter, the Rector Major mentions two significant events: the passing of the saintly Rector Major emeritus, Father Renato Ziggiotti, in Albarts (Verona) on April 19, and the beatification of Bishop Luigi Versiglia and Father Caruvario by Pope John Paul II at St. Peter’s on May 15. He plans to commemorate Father Ziggiotti further in a forthcoming mortuary letter. However, he briefly acknowledges Father Ziggiotti’s twelve-year tenure as Superior General, which coincided with a challenging period for the Congregation, marked by the aftermath of World War II and the preparations for Vatican II. This period saw significant cultural shifts and tensions, setting the stage for the events of 1968.
